Bill Cunningham New York @ Duke Of York's, Brighton


For anyone else who gets that nice, lazy Sunday evening 'I really want to watch a good film' impulse, the Duke Of York's in Brighton have you sorted this week. They'll be joining London, Edinburgh, Belfast and other UK cities showing this awesome documentary on New York Times street style photographer Bill Cunningham.

Before the internet was even a thing, let alone a place for the likes of The Sartorialist, Tommy Ton's Jak & Jil blog and Stockholm Street Style, Bill Cunningham was out on Manhattan's streets snapping away and documenting micro-trends as they happened.

This film is a beautiful, honest and really well put together look behind the scenes at what's made him tick for all these years, and features several of his muses speaking on camera about him for the first time ever.
